Benefits of Boxing for youth

here are five key reasons why the younger generation can benefit from exercise and physical combat sports like boxing:

1. **Physical Health and Fitness**: Regular exercise, including boxing, promotes cardiovascular health, builds strength, and enhances overall physical fitness. This contributes to healthy growth and development, improving energy levels and reducing the risk of childhood obesity.

2. **Mental Health and Emotional Resilience**: Physical activity helps reduce stress, anxiety, and depression by releasing endorphins, the brain’s “feel-good” chemicals. Boxing, in particular, teaches emotional control and provides a safe outlet for managing frustration and anger.

3. **Discipline and Self-Control**: Combat sports like boxing require discipline, focus, and patience. Learning techniques, practicing regularly, and following rules help young people develop self-control, which can positively impact their behavior in other areas of life.

4. **Confidence and Self-Esteem**: Achieving goals in physical activities can boost self-confidence. Overcoming challenges in boxing, such as learning new skills or succeeding in a match, builds a sense of accomplishment and improves self-esteem.

5. **Social Skills and Teamwork**: Participating in structured physical activities fosters a sense of belonging, teaches teamwork, and helps develop communication skills. Although boxing can be an individual sport, training often involves collaboration with coaches and peers, which nurtures social interaction and cooperation.
